Joining me this episode is Mac from the Shuttertime Podcast. After going through an "existential midlife crisis," Mac talks to me about a photo he created during a recent trip he and his wife took and the limits he placed on himself while on this trip. Sometimes having limits can help to resolve a crisis and help create a once-in-a-lifetime photo. We also catch up on a bunch of other photo stuff.
